Compare all specifications:
2003 Avanti Sport Convertible | 2008 Maybach 62 | |
Make | Avanti | Maybach |
Model | Sport Convertible | 62 |
Year Released | 2003 | 2008 |
Engine Size | 5700 cc | 5513 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 12 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 542 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line - Premium |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Vehicle Weight | 1650 kg | 2855 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4720 mm | 6170 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1990 mm | 1990 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1330 mm | 1580 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2570 mm | 3830 mm |
